Private medical insurance provider AXA PPP healthcare has extended its agreement with digital healthcare provider, Doctor Care Anywhere.

The extension involves a new three-year deal to enhance the service AXA PPP healthcare provides through its virtual GP offer Doctor@Hand.

Under the new agreement with Doctor Care Anywhere, the Doctor@Hand service offers two new enhancements.

Health Tracking app

First is the Doctor Care Anywhere Health Tracking app, which provides condition-led symptom tracking and medication reminders.

The app is designed to improve compliance and adherence to medication, increase engagement with self-management and improve information for GP diagnoses, as patients have the ability to generate health reports to share with their doctor.

Doctor Care Anywhere said research published in 2012 and conducted over a number of years, concluded that access to one’s own patient record and consultation notes increased medication adherence on average by 69%.

 The virtual GP cited research saying the number one reason for the failure of management of chronic disease is poor adherence to prescriptions (about 50% of all patients) resulting in a poorer quality of life and time off work.

Repeat prescriptions

The second enhancement means AXA PPP healthcare members can fulfil their NHS repeat prescriptions via the Doctor Care Anywhere platform.

Prescriptions can be collected from a local participating pharmacy and a delivery service is due to go live later this year.

Doctor Care Anywhere said the Doctor@Hand service offering has been one of AXA PPP healthcare’s most successful value added services to date both for corporate clients and their employees.

The provider said the Fast Track Appointments referral pathway from Doctor Care Anywhere GPs to AXA PPP healthcare recommended specialists has been particularly popular and showcases the speed, convenience and efficiency of the integrated service.

Doctor@Hand is available as an enhancement to AXA PPP healthcare’s medical insurance plans or as a standalone service for individuals, SMEs and large corporate clients.

Paul Moulton, intermediary distribution director for AXA PPP healthcare, commented: “Doctor@Hand is proving to be a popular service for members of our corporate healthcare schemes, with reassuringly positive feedback. Employers have been quick to appreciate that, for busy, hardworking employees, Doctor@Hand's easy to access service is a welcome alternative to taking the time and trouble to get in to see their NHS GP.

Indeed, we know from our own research that working parents with dependent children can find it difficult to get a doctor's appointment during working hours – 83 per cent of the parents we surveyed ranked this as being 'most difficult'.”

Kate Newhouse, CEO of Doctor Care Anywhere, said: “Our belief is that our ongoing partnership with AXA PPP healthcare, helps employers in their efforts to ensure that their workforce is healthy and happy, while employees can have the comfort of knowing that they can take control of their health by seeing a GP when needed.”
